ScottPJones / Mongo.jl

Mongo bindings for the Julia programming language
Other
43 stars 21 forks source link

Problem installing mongo.jl on Mac OS #19

Closed rogerwhitney closed 8 years ago

rogerwhitney commented 8 years ago

I am new to Julia and am trying to use the Mongo package. I am using Julia 0.4.6 on Mac OS 10.11.6. When I try to add (or build) the package using Pkg.add("Mongo") or Pkg.build("Mongo")I get the error:

"Error: Cannot install mongo-c because conflicting formulae are installed. libbson: because mongo-c installs the libbson headers Please brew unlink libbson before continuing.

Unlinking removes a formula's symlinks from /Users/whitney/.julia/v0.4/Homebrew/deps/usr. You can link the formula again after the install finishes. You can --force this install, but the build may fail or cause obscure side-effects in the resulting software."

I then tried to unlink libbson using: Homebrew.brew(unlink libbson) and then tried building Mongo again, but had the same error.

n-raghu commented 8 years ago

MongoPackageError.txt

I am also facing the same issue, unable to add Mongo package in Julia. Getting the same error. I am using El Capitan and the version of Julia is 0.4.6

ghost commented 8 years ago

Thanks guys, looks like something changed in Homebrew, I'm trying out a fix right now.

ghost commented 8 years ago

This should now be fixed, please re-open if you are still experiencing this issue after Pkg.update() then Pkg.add("Mongo")

n-raghu commented 8 years ago

thanks @pzion , its now working.

rogerwhitney commented 8 years ago

Working for me too. Thanks.


Roger Whitney Department of Computer Science whitney@sdsu.edu San Diego State University http://www.eli.sdsu.edu/ San Diego, CA 92182-7720

On Sep 12, 2016, at 5:10 AM, nenandu notifications@github.com wrote:

thanks @pzion https://github.com/pzion , its now working.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/pzion/Mongo.jl/issues/19#issuecomment-246328261, or mute the thread https://github.com/notifications/unsubscribe-auth/AA1X9hJJQBD9KJWPMmvgaYZx3f4Ykzuxks5qpUFDgaJpZM4JbDeF.